Hi! I think you could solve this with csound, which by now supports alsa-midi as well. But I don't know how exactly to do it. There are phase-vocoder opcodes (pvadd for instance). Which can stretch a sound. I don't know if these opcodes can play the sound in reverse. But you could assign a midi-controller to the speed. For further info, if you're interested at all, you could ask the csound-mailinglist. See Dave's fantastic linux-sound page for this: http://linux-sound.org I hope that helps.
